--- miscJava/bukkit-minecraft-plugins/HoerupUtils/src/main/java/dk/thoerup/bukkit/hoeruputils/message/MessageWrapper.java 2017/05/31 08:59:22 3202 +++ miscJava/bukkit-minecraft-plugins/HoerupUtils/src/main/java/dk/thoerup/bukkit/hoeruputils/message/MessageWrapper.java 2017/06/01 13:16:06 3203 @@ -13,7 +13,10 @@ import org.bukkit.plugin.Plugin; import org.bukkit.scheduler.BukkitScheduler; -import com.avaje.ebean.EbeanServer; + + +import io.ebean.Ebean; +import io.ebean.EbeanServer; import java.sql.Timestamp; @@ -23,17 +26,12 @@ Plugin plugin; - public MessageWrapper(Plugin plugin, Runnable installer) { + public MessageWrapper(Plugin plugin) { this.plugin = plugin; - server = plugin.getDatabase(); - - try { - server.find(MessageBean.class).findRowCount(); //probe - } catch (Exception e) { - - installer.run(); - } + server = Ebean.getDefaultServer(); + + server.find(MessageBean.class).findCount(); //probe } @EventHandler